SSL_pending man page on DigitalUNIX

Man page or keyword search:  
man Server   12896 pages
apropos Keyword Search (all sections)
Output format
DigitalUNIX logo
[printable version]

SSL_pending(3)							SSL_pending(3)

NAME
       SSL_pending - Obtain number of readable bytes buffered in an SSL object

SYNOPSIS
       #include <openssl/ssl.h>

       int SSL_pending(
	       SSL *ssl );

DESCRIPTION
       The SSL_pending() function returns the number of bytes which are availā€
       able inside ssl for immediate read.

NOTES
       Data are received in blocks  from  the  peer.  Therefore	 data  can  be
       buffered	 inside	 ssl  and  are	ready for immediate retrieval with the
       SSL_read() function.

RESTRICTIONS
       The SSL_pending() function takes	 into  account	only  bytes  from  the
       TLS/SSL	record	that is being processed (if any).  If the SSL object's
       read_ahead flag is set, additional protocol bytes may  have  been  read
       containing more TLS/SSL records; these are ignored by the SSL_pending()
       function.

       Up to OpenSSL 0.9.6, the SSL_pending() function does not check  if  the
       record type of pending data is application data.

RETURN VALUES
       The number of bytes pending is returned.

SEE ALSO
       Function: SSL_read(3), ssl(3)

								SSL_pending(3)
[top]

List of man pages available for DigitalUNIX

Copyright (c) for man pages and the logo by the respective OS vendor.

For those who want to learn more, the polarhome community provides shell access and support.

[legal] [privacy] [GNU] [policy] [cookies] [netiquette] [sponsors] [FAQ]
Tweet
Polarhome, production since 1999.
Member of Polarhome portal.
Based on Fawad Halim's script.
....................................................................
Vote for polarhome
Free Shell Accounts :: the biggest list on the net